The detection of the interface between turbulent and nonturbulent zones in slightly heated turbulent shear flows on the basis of a temperature signal is discussed. Two detection parameters, a threshold level or gate &dgr;&thgr;gand a hold time &tgr;h, are used. A complete description of the detection process and of the procedure used to select nominal values for the detection param eters is presented. It is shown that the detection process is credible in the sense that the statistics of the intermittency function are nearly independent of the values of the detection parameters. Comparison of the intermittency function statistics with previous results is made.
